Why Riverside Homes Are Different

Riverside sits directly on Long Island Sound, meaning chimneys here face constant salt-laden marine air that accelerates mortar joint erosion, corrodes steel dampers and caps, and degrades clay tile liners far faster than in inland Fairfield County towns. The neighborhood’s concentration of 1920s–1950s Greenwich estate homes — many with three or more fireplaces used only seasonally — means liners and crowns are already aged and then hammered by salt air between each burning season, making annual inspection here genuinely critical rather than precautionary.

Chimney Repair in Riverside

Riverside’s estate chimneys demand more than standard repair approaches. The original lime-based mortars in these 1920s–1960s homes breathe properly but absorb salt-laden moisture that expands and contracts through freeze-thaw cycles. We regularly find 1930s-era joints reduced to sand between bricks on Shore Road properties, and hairline cracks in clay flue tiles that salt air has widened during dormant seasons. Mortar Repointing

We remove deteriorated mortar to proper depth, then match replacement mix to original color and compressive strength. On a recent Shore Road job, we found joints eroded to half their original depth after just fifteen years; inland, that same mortar might have lasted decades. Targeted mortar repointing in Riverside runs $850–$2,400 depending on chimney height and joint exposure.

Spalling Brick Repair

Spalling — the flaking of brick faces — is epidemic in Riverside’s 06878 ZIP. South- and west-facing chimney exposures take the brunt of Sound-driven weather, popping surfaces off bricks. We replace spalled units with matching brick, address the moisture source, and often recommend crown rebuilding to prevent recurrence. Partial chimney face repair typically costs $1,200–$3,800.

Why do my Riverside chimney’s mortar joints look powdery after just a few years?

Salt-laden marine air from Long Island Sound accelerates mortar erosion by wicking chloride moisture into joints, then subjecting them to freeze-thaw cycling each winter. The original lime mortars in 1920s–1960s estate homes are particularly vulnerable — breathable, which is correct, but porous enough to admit damaging salts. Creosote Removal

Riverside’s humid, salt-laden air creates a unique creosote problem. When fireplaces sit unused through spring and summer, coastal moisture wicks into the flue and binds with existing deposits, creating a tacky, corrosive layer. Our rotary sweeping with polypropylene brushes — never wire on old clay tiles — breaks this down without damage. Heavy creosote removal in Riverside runs $280–$380.

Do I really need an annual inspection if I only use my fireplace a few times each winter?

Yes — in Riverside, infrequent use combined with salt-air exposure creates a specific failure pattern. Moisture enters during long dormant periods; without regular firing to dry the system, that moisture degrades mortar and cracks clay liners unseen. Gas Fireplace Service

Gas fireplaces in Riverside’s renovated estates often sit in original masonry openings retrofitted with inserts — and the conversion work isn’t always done right. We service pilot assemblies, thermopiles, and gas valves in units where flue sizing from a 1980s renovation no longer matches the BTU output. A typical gas fireplace service in Riverside runs $180–$320. Anthony checks for proper draft, carbon monoxide spillage, and whether your insert was paired with a compatible liner.

Wood-Burning Fireplace Repair

Riverside’s original wood-burning fireplaces — many in 1920s–1950s Colonials and Georgians — weren’t designed for the intermittent, decorative fires most owners burn today, which actually produces more creosote than daily use. We clean, inspect, and repair these systems with an eye toward the salt-air degradation that accelerates mortar failure in fireboxes facing Long Island Sound. Firebox repointing or minor repair typically costs $350–$650.

Crown Repair

The crown is the concrete or mortar slab that seals the chimney top between the flue tiles and the edge. On Riverside’s Sound-front homes, crown mortar spalls faster due to consistent humidity and salt deposition, leading to gaps that admit rainwater into the flue system. We remove deteriorated material, reform the crown with proper slope and overhang, and seal it with HeatShield coating. Crown coating typically costs $350–$580; full crown rebuild with coating runs $720–$1,400.

Stainless Steel Liner Installation

A stainless steel liner is the standard replacement for failed clay tile in Riverside’s estate homes, and we install DuraFlex systems sized precisely to your original flue dimensions. The marine air here doesn’t negotiate — once clay tiles crack, moisture gets behind them every season, and steel is the only practical long-term solution. On a 1930s Georgian-revival estate near the Riverside Yacht Club, we uncovered a full-depth crack in the original clay-tile liner that had been masked by decades of seasonal creosote buildup. Stainless steel liner installation runs $2,800–$4,500.

Flexible Liner Systems

Not every Riverside chimney has a straight shot from hearth to crown. Many of these 1920s–1960s homes have offset flues, structural bends, or tight cleanout access that rigid pipe simply won’t navigate. We use flexible stainless systems — DuraFlex and Olympia Chimney products — that conform to existing masonry without compromising draft performance. Installation in Riverside’s taller estate chimneys typically falls between $3,200–$5,200.
